Thought Based Therapy for Everyday Living: Tools and Techniques for Personal Growth

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) is a powerful strategy that equips individuals with practical tools to manage everyday challenges and foster personal growth. It emphasizes the interconnectedness of our thoughts, feelings, and behaviors, highlighting how negative thought patterns can contribute to emotional distress and unproductive behaviors. Through CBT, individuals learn to identify, recognize, pinpoint these thought patterns, challenge their validity, and replace them with more adaptive ones.

  • CBT provides a range of techniques, including:
  • Cognitive restructuring: A process of identifying and modifying negative thoughts.
  • Behavioral activation: Engaging in activities that promote mood and alleviate avoidance behaviors.
  • Exposure therapy: Gradually confronting anxieties in a safe and structured environment.

By implementing these tools, individuals can develop emotional resilience, improve their interactions, and achieve greater happiness in their lives. CBT is a adaptable therapy that can be adjusted to meet the unique needs of each individual, making it an effective tool for personal growth and change.

Mindful Shifts: The Impact of CBT on Well-being

CBT, a powerful therapeutic approach, has demonstrated profound impacts on individual well-being. By focusing on the interplay between thoughts, feelings, and behaviors|cognitions, emotions, and actions, CBT equips individuals with the tools to modify negative thought patterns that fuel distress. Through structured exercises and techniques, individuals learn to foster healthier coping mechanisms, improve emotional regulation, and achieve greater psychological resilience. The success of CBT in addressing a wide range of conditions, such as anxiety, depression, and PTSD, speaks to its impactful potential in promoting lasting well-being.
